Understanding Acne Scars:

Acne scars can develop as a result of inflammatory acne lesions, such as cysts, papules, pustules, or nodules, that damage the skin’s collagen and elastin fibers. There are different types of acne scars, including:

Laser Therapy:

Laser treatments, such as fractional laser therapy or intense pulsed light (IPL) therapy, can help stimulate collagen production and resurface the skin, reducing the appearance of acne scars.

Topical Treatments:

Certain topical treatments, such as retinoids or alpha hydroxy acids (AHAs), can help improve the appearance of acne scars over time by promoting cell turnover and collagen production.

Microneedling:

Microneedling involves the use of tiny needles to create micro-injuries in the skin, stimulating collagen production and promoting smoother, more even skin texture.

Chemical Peels:

Chemical peels involve the application of a chemical solution to the skin, which exfoliates the outer layer of damaged skin cells and promotes the growth of new, healthier skin.
